Score 87/100 · Robert Parker, Dec 2009
Both the 2006 Cabernet Sauvignon Estate and 2006 Cabernet Sauvignon Napa are also narrowly constructed. The latter wine, which I assume is made from purchased fruit, exhibits more ripe fruit, but again, lots of oak. I have higher hopes for Duckhorn's 2007s than the bevy of 2006s I tasted. While they are good, most had issues with hard, aggressive tannins as well as high acid levels that give the wines clipped personalities. In short, if a wine tastes too tannic, it is too tannic, and that may be the problem with Duckhorn's 2006s.
